Ukraine's Bitcoin foray comes during a broader struggle to define the nation's virtual-assets framework. Following months of negotiations and revisions, a comprehensive draft law on virtual assets was unanimously approved by the Verkhovna Rada Committee in late April[1]. However, the bill was abruptly withdrawn at the request of the Presidential Office, due to concerns raised by the National Securities and Stock Market Commission and its chair, Ruslan Magomedov[1].
Despite the hurdles, Ukraine remains one of the world's major sovereign Bitcoin holders, boasting a stash of approximately 46,351 BTC, valued at nearly $4.8 billion as of current market prices[1]. A significant portion of these assets can be traced back to donations collected through various fundraisers and seizures resulting from corruption investigations[1].

Kyiv's crypto strategy echoes that of the United States, as both nations eye a future where digital assets play a pivotal role in their economic strategies[1]. In March 2025, the United States established the Strategic Bitcoin Reserve, housing all Bitcoin seized in federal criminal and civil cases[1]. Ukraine appears to be following a similar blueprint, seeking budget-neutral methods to bolster its own digital horde[1].
